How Demo Play Differs From Real-Money Spinning
Demo play removes the financial stakes entirely, so each spin carries no risk of loss, unlike real-money spinning where your balance fluctuates with every outcome. This fundamental difference means demo play cannot replicate the psychological pressure of wagering actual cash, making pure entertainment the only goal. Wins and losses in demo mode are purely cosmetic, with no cash value or withdrawal capability. Real-money spins, conversely, directly impact your bankroll and can trigger real-world consequences like deposit limits or session timers.
- Demo spins use fictional credits that reset, while real-money spins use funds from your deposited balance.
- Real-money spinning unlocks progressive jackpots and cash bonuses; demo mode excludes these payout features.
- Demo play has no wagering requirements or cash-out restrictions, unlike real-money winnings which typically require playthrough conditions.

Identifying High-Volatility vs. Low-Volatility Games
In free slots, identifying whether a game is high or low volatility is crucial for tailoring your demo experience. High-volatility titles, such as Dead or Alive, are characterized by infrequent but substantial payouts, making them ideal for players seeking high-risk, high-reward sessions. Low-volatility games, like Starburst, produce frequent small wins to extend playtime with less bankroll fluctuation. To spot this, examine the paytable: high-volatility slots often feature large maximum win multipliers alongside sparse bonus triggers. Conversely, low-volatility games show numerous small-win combinations and frequent base-game hits. Testing spin sequences in demo mode reveals the true payout rhythm before committing real funds.
| Aspect | High Volatility | Low Volatility |
|---|---|---|
| Win Frequency | Low, with long dry spells | High, with constant small wins |
| Payout Size | Large, often via bonus rounds | Small to moderate |
| Bonus Feature Rate | Rare but highly rewarding | Frequent but modest |
